Wonderful (and Long!) 1840 Letter from Elias A Brown To "My Dear Wife," with Beautiful Cross Writing Victorian era All limbs well attached andI have for a long time wanted to turn up a good example of cross writing, shown here on the first page of this letter, brilliantly (and beautifully!) used in the early mid 19th century as a way of conserving space and paper. I just love to look at it! But happily this is a pretty wonderful and notable letter, too, written from Elias A Brown to his dear wife Louisa Anna (Cady) Brown in Minaville, Montgomery County, NY, 1840.
